Output 26148c51a59797c955d86eb3f0d4d3e9400c7d6b7a75984a95f427b56f832f8c:3

value
19420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f91ba834bbacc4e94d1396233861480561328604 OP_EQUAL
address
3QQBJxN8WyVDLuKNDVqJxRFb6dVfap4nhx
transaction
26148c51a59797c955d86eb3f0d4d3e9400c7d6b7a75984a95f427b56f832f8c
confirmations
295593
spent
true